Summary

This study explores a new way to separate large sugar molecules from smaller ones using a special kind of ceramic filter made from a cheap material called Fuller's earth. The filter was made by pressing and heating the material, resulting in a stable structure with tiny pores. When tested, the filter let small sugars like glucose and sucrose pass through while keeping larger sugars like cellulose and starch behind. The filter worked well under different pressures and conditions, and the researchers found out how it got clogged during use. They think this filter could be useful in industries like food processing, medicine, and environmental cleanup because it's both effective and affordable.
